    Linear programming (LP), also called linear optimization, is a method to achieve the best outcome (such as maximum profit or lowest cost) in a mathematical model whose requirements and objective are represented by linear relationships. Linear programming is a special case of mathematical programming (also known as mathematical optimization).

Linear programming (LP) is a method to achieve the optimum outcome under some requirements represented by linear relationships. More precisely, LP can solve the problem of maximizing or minimizing a linear objective function subject to some linear constraints.
